Soft, fluffy, and gooey cinnamon rolls made completely dairy-free and egg-free—perfect for a cozy treat!
Ingredients:
For the Dough:
- 3 ½ cups all-purpose flour (or bread flour)
- 2 ¼ tsp active dry yeast (1 packet)
- ¼ cup sugar (coconut or cane)
- 1 cup warm plant-based milk (almond, soy, or oat)
- ¼ cup vegan butter, melted (or coconut oil)
- ½ tsp salt
For the Cinnamon Filling:
- ½ cup brown sugar
- 2 tbsp cinnamon
- ¼ cup vegan butter, softened
For the Glaze:
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 2 tbsp plant-based milk
- ½ tsp vanilla extract
Instructions:
- Activate the Yeast: In a bowl, mix warm plant milk, sugar, and yeast. Let sit for 5-10 minutes until foamy.
- Make the Dough: In a large bowl, combine flour and salt. Add melted vegan butter and the yeast mixture. Mix and knead for 8-10 minutes until smooth and elastic.
- Let It Rise: Cover and let dough rise in a warm place for 1-1.5 hours, or until doubled in size.
- Prepare the Filling: Mix brown sugar and cinnamon in a bowl.
- Roll It Out: On a floured surface, roll the dough into a 12×18-inch rectangle. Spread softened vegan butter evenly, then sprinkle the cinnamon-sugar mixture.
- Shape the Rolls: Roll the dough tightly from the longer side, then slice into 10-12 rolls.
- Second Rise: Place rolls in a greased baking dish, cover, and let rise again for 30-45 minutes.
- Bake: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and bake for 20-25 minutes, until golden brown.
- Make the Glaze: Mix powdered sugar, plant milk, and vanilla until smooth. Drizzle over warm rolls.

Optional Add-ins:
✔️ Nutty flavor? Add chopped pecans or walnuts to the filling.
✔️ Caramel touch? Drizzle with maple syrup before baking.
✔️ Extra fluffy? Use bread flour instead of all-purpose flour.
